How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 4X4?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 4X4 Studio Apartments | $1,510 | $695 | $2,646 |
| 4X4 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,554 | $550 | $2,939 |
| 4X4 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,917 | $900 | $4,499 |
| 4X4 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,431 | $1,300 | $4,570 |
4X4 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,045 | $909 | $3,600 |
